// Notes for the weekly eng sync re: Gallerywhisper, our museum audio-guide app.
// This constant sets the prefetch radius for exhibit audio clips. At the
// Hollen Pavilion pilot we learned visitors walk faster than our original
// estimate, so clips were buffering mid-stride. Bumping this to three rooms
// ahead fixed it, at a modest bandwidth cost. Don't lower it without testing
// on the slow gallery wifi first — seriously, it's painful. The trace token
// from the pilot build that validated this number is appended just below.

trace token, kahap-bagaf: htk4_8458

TURN-208: Gatevale turnstile counters at the Merrow Field pilot double-count when a rotation reverses mid-cycle. Attendance totals drift roughly 2% high per event. The debounce window fix is implemented, reviewed by Ilsa, and soak-tested across two simulated match days without drift. Ready for your cut; the candidate build is identified below.

trace token, tagag-tafog: htk6_5ed18c

Night shift: evacuation-chair store on Stairwell C, Level 3, was restocked today. Two Havermont chairs serviced, one sent to Drayle Safety for repair. Check the seal on the store door at 02:00 rounds. If the seal is broken, log it and re-secure. Door access for the store uses the pass below.

staff pass of fajop-kajop = bdg-H-83